Police repel terrorists in Katsina

The Police in Katsina say one suspected terrorist has been killed and many others sustained gunshot wounds,one AK 47 rifle with twenty-two rounds of live 7.62 millimeters ammunition recovered in an encounter on Monday.

 

Spokesman of the Katsina Police Command, Gambo Isah said in a statement that the incident occurred at Kesassa village in Danmusa Local Government Area of the state.

 

According to him, on March 27 at about 2:30 pm, a distress call was received that terrorists in their numbers, shooting sporadically with AK 47 rifles, blocked Danmusa – Yantumaki Road in Danmusa Local Government Area.

 

He said as a result of the call, the District Police Officer, DPO, led a team of policemen to the area, engaged the hoodlums in a gun duel and successfully repelled them.

 

Isah added that in the course of scanning the scene, one of the terrorists was neutralized and his dead body recovered.

 

Additionally, one AK 47 rifle with twenty-two rounds of 7.62mm live ammunition of AK 47 rifle was also recovered.

 

Many of the terrorists according to the police image maker, were reasonably believed to have been neutralized and/or escaped the scene with gunshot wounds saying, search parties are combing the nearest bushes with a view to arresting them or recovering their dead bodies.

 

The Command appealed to members of the communities in the area to report to the nearest police station any person found or seen with a suspected gunshot injury.
